Taking a stance on the trance

What do hypnosis and market research have in common? For one US researcher, his interest in both has led him to business hypnotising focus group subjects.
This point of difference in the competitive market research industry is based on the fact he believes people lie or exaggerate for all sorts of reasons in focus groups.
However, through hypnosis they’re more relaxed and the answers are more honest.
